This card started with the inspiration to make a frosted “glass parfait dish” ful of strawberries from Papertrey Ink. I just had to use my Little Ladybug and so the picnic theme evolved from there. The “frosted” dish is actually a piece of cardstock vellum punched with a scalloped oval punch and put through the Cuttlebug to emboss it. I used the swirl embossing folder so that you would be able to see the strawberries but still get a fun swirled glass look. The top of the oval was trimmed off . Before adhering it to the design, I stamped a bunch of little strawberries from Papertrey Ink’s Green Thumb set and cut them out. After adhering them to the central square, I stitched the “bowl” to the card.

A picnic always needs a nice red plaid or gingham tablecloth to my next step was to stamp one using Papertrey Ink’s darling Faux Ribbon set. I can’t believe how flexible this set is. It was so quick and easy to make this plaid. I simply lined up three different “ribbon” stamps together on one acrylic block and then inked and stamped. I started out with a 3×3 white square and it was super easy to eyeball where the stamping needed to go.

After adhering all my layers together, all the card needed was a few finishing touches. A fun little “celebrate” sentiment on the bottom of the image and a Little Lady flying in to check out the lucious berries. The ladybug and the trail are highlighted with a black Sakura Gelly Roll Glaze Gel Pen for a glossy dimensional look.

Supply List:

Cardstock: Whisper White, Real Red, Cool Caribbean, Vellum – Stampin Up

Stamps: Faux Ribbon, Little Lady, Green Thumb – Papertrey Ink

 Ink: Basic Black, Real Red, Old Olive – Stampin Up

Other: sewing machine, Cuttlebug & Cuttlebug embossing folder – Provocraft, Black Glaze Gel Pen – Sakura, Scalloped Oval Punch – Marvy
